Outline of Final Research Achievements

In order to evaluate the fatigue properties of CFRP laminates in the very high cycle region, i.e. more than 10,000,000 cycles, within a practical period, the feasibility study of an ultrasonic fatigue testing method for CFRP laminates was conducted. The experimental study revealed that it is possible to conduct axial fatigue testing of CFRP laminates by using an open-hole specimen with air cooling and intermittent loading.
